Presentation Transcript


  1. East Asia Test Review

  2. How did the Silk Road affect East Asia? Cultural Diffusion

  3. How was Buddhism introduced to China? • The Silk Roads

  4. Why is Japan so susceptible to earthquakes and volcanoes? Ring of Fire

  5. China’s population growth has been predicted to triple by 2080. How will this affect them? • Urbanization • Lack of fresh water

  6. How do summer monsoon winds affect China? Flooding

  7. What is a major problem in the large cities in China? Pollution

  8. What physical process in MOST responsible for danxia? Erosion

  9. When the government controls the economy of a country, it is known as communism.What country in East Asia is communist with a strong dictator? North Korea

  10. How is the character of Mongolia apparent? Nomadic Lifestyle

  11. Hong Kong built an international airport by building an artificial island. Why? • Hong Kong is small and dense with little available land

  12. Cultural convergence is the contact and interaction from one country to another. Which of these photos best illustrates that? 

  13. In 1961 South Korea exported raw silk, iron ore, and cuttlefish. Today, South Korea exports cars, ships, and automobile parts. What can you infer about South Korea? It is becoming industrialized

  14. What level of economic activities was South Korea in 1961 (cuttlefish, iron ore, and raw silk?) 

  15. Using the graph, determine if China or the world is growing at a faster rate.

  16. Why is there limited farming and forestry in western China? Terrain is mountainous and climate is dry

  17. How will additional airport construction in China affect the country? • Increase Trade • Connect people

  18. What caused the division of North Korea and South Korea? • Military Conflict

  19. China has an export ban on essential minerals to Japan. How has this affected relations? Heightened concerns & caused tensions

  20. China and Taiwan split in 1949. They continue to have differing points of view on what issue? • Independence for Taiwan

  21. North Korea is encouraging people to migrate to rural areas. Japan wants to promote controlled immigration to the country. Which factor (below) contributed to the change in Japan? In North Korea? N.K. is changing for political factors, Japan for social

  22. Juche is a political communist ideology used in North Korea. Why is it unique? Based on political leadership

  23. What building project in East Asia is an engineering marvel with costly side effects? Three Gorges Dam

  24. What is the intended effect of Japanese seawalls? Protection from Tsunamis

  25. Identify the countries of East Asia. Which country experienced a major nuclear power plant accident caused by a tsunami? • Japan
